Azamara announces its return to Venice in 2023

Azamara has announced the cruise line’s return to Venice, beginning April 3, 2023, as part of Azamara Journey’s 12-Night The Best of The Med Voyage.

Starting next spring, the line’s four-ship fleet will access the Venetian Lagoon ports of Chioggia and Fusina, allowing guests to marvel at gondolas, stroll the cobblestone streets, and explore Venice.

“Thanks to our longstanding relationship with the local officials and port authorities of Venice, we’re thrilled to not only bring our guests back to this historic canal city, but also to allow them to discover the wonders of neighbouring towns such as Chioggia, which only smaller ships can visit,” Mike Pawlus, Azamara’s director of strategic itinerary & destination planning, said.

“We look forward to once again immersing our guests in the rich local culture and amazing historical sites that the destination has to offer.”

In addition to exploring the streets and canals of Venice, Azamara’s giving guests the opportunity to explore Chioggia, which has recently experienced a rise in tourism due to the flourishing of bacari, bars serving wine and finger food along the central canal, Riva Vena.

Highlights of the upcoming sailings to Venice include:

  • 7-Night Italy Intensive Voyage – This seven-night Country Intensive itinerary encourages guests to explore Italy with late nights in Ravenna, Kotor and Amalfi, and an overnight stay in Rome, giving travellers time to explore views, ancient cities and the local culture in each destination.
  • 7-Night Amalfi & Dalmatian Coasts Voyage – Travellers aboard this seven-night voyage have the opportunity to dive into the shorelines of the Amalfi and Dalmatian Coasts, with four late stays, including Sorrento, Kotor, Dubrovnik and Sibenik as well as an enchanting overnight stay in Venice, where guests can enjoy people watching in the Piazza San Marco, sampling Veneto wines, and admiring Murano’s handcrafted glass and swathes of silk.

Venice shore excursions on offer include:

  • An intimate evening gondola ride accompanied by a local singer and an accordionist, creating a classic and romantic Venetian experience.
  • A motorboat cruise to neighbouring isles, Murano and Burano, where guests will enjoy a tour of an acclaimed glass-blowing factory, as well as a demonstration of traditional lace-making techniques.
  • A guided walking tour with a local expert including visits to the beautiful church of Saint Rocco and Campo San Polo, one of the oldest squares in Venice.
